THE Midlands Air Ambulance from Strensham was scrambled following reports of a car crash on the A448 The Slough in Studley on Saturday, October 9.
The alarm was raised at 2.46pm and two ambulances and three paramedic officers were also sent to the scene.
On arrival ambulance crews found two patients, both men.
The first, the driver of one of the cars, had sustained serious injuries and he received advanced trauma care before being taken to the Queen Elizabeth Hospital in Birmingham by land ambulance for further treatment.
The second man, the driver of the other car, was assessed on scene and found to have sustained injuries not considered to be serious.
He was conveyed to Alexandra Hospital by land ambulance for further assessment.
